The Prophet ﷺ ate from the shoulder of a sheep, then rinsed his mouth, washed his hands, and prayed.
وبهذا الإسناد أن النبي ﷺ أكل كتف شاة فمضمض وغسل يده وصلى
Its isnad is sahih, it was mentioned previously at 1987 and 1988. Bukhari narrated it, 1/310, no. 207 Fath, and Muslim, 1/273, no. 355, in the chapter on menstruation, the abrogation of wudu due to what fire has touched, and Shafii, 13, from Umaya Damri.
